Mercy (Middle English, from Anglo-French merci, from Medieval Latin merced-, merces, from Latin, "price paid, wages", from merc-, merxi "merchandise") is a broad term that refers to benevolence, forgiveness and kindness in a variety of ethical, religious, social and legal contexts.

英英词典
leniency n.
  1. mercifulness as a consequence of being lenient or tolerant

  2. synonymous: lenience, mildness, lenity
  3. a disposition to yield to the wishes of someone

  4. synonymous: indulgence, lenience
  5. lightening a penalty or excusing from a chore by judges or parents or teachers

  6. synonymous: lenience
